Top 10 podcasts for truckers

We don’t have to tell you that truckers spend a lot of hours on the road. The routine of driving and listening to the radio or music might be getting tired – sometimes our brains get bored if they listen to the same type of media for hours on end. So why not try something new to keep you entertained as you drive? Podcasts are a great source of entertainment that you can enjoy behind the wheel. They’re informative, thought-provoking, and, we admit, somewhat addicting. (But at least they might help you prevent driver fatigue!) If you’ve never tried a podcast before, we definitely recommend it to change up your routine a little. Check out these ten podcasts for truckers.

1. Serial

Genre: True Crime/Mystery

Host Sarah Koenig investigates a murder from 1999 in Serial. 18-year-old Hae Min Lee was found dead in a park close to where she lived. Adnan Syed, a former boyfriend of Hae Min’s, was arrested, brought to trial, and found guilty of the murder. But Koenig picks apart the case in her podcast, trying to get to the truth. Is Syed guilty? Learn about the details of the case and decide for yourself.

2. Stuff You Should Know (from How Stuff Works)

Genre: Information about everything – science, history, pop culture, etc.

Join hosts Josh Clark and Chuck Bryant as they tackle a variety of topics. They delve into science, history, pop culture, and more. The goal is to explain about…well, everything. They have episodes on many different topics, and they share stuff you should know about in an entertaining and even comedic way.

3. Atlanta Monster

Genre: True Crime/Mystery

We’re in Atlanta in the 1980s. Children are disappearing from the city streets, and Wayne Williams is accused of the murders and sent to prison. Journalist Payne Lindsay unpacks the case in an attempt to get to the truth: did Williams kill the children who went missing in Atlanta between 1979 and 1981? Find out about the implications of this case.

4. This American Life

Genre: Journalism

This podcast gives a weekly public radio show that tells people’s stories. It’s extremely popular, having won many awards.

5. How I Built This

Genre: Business/Entrepreneurship

How I Built This makes the list of podcasts for truckers because host Guy Raz explores the stories behind successful businesses and companies by interviewing idealists and innovators. He asks how they built what they built and gets the story behind the movement they began. Find out how many of the companies we’re familiar with today got their start.

6. Stuff to Blow Your Mind (from How Stuff Works)

Genre: Science

Robert Lamb and Joe McCormick explore different questions about how we think, how the brain works, and some of the universe’s mysteries. Basically, they explore the strangeness of our reality. As far as interesting podcasts for truckers, this one will, well, blow your mind.

7. The Daily Boost (with Scott Smith)

Genre: Motivational

Scott Smith hosts this motivational podcast designed to help you through the stress and anxiety of life. It covers topics like scheduling, handling stress, and more. Smith is funny and straightforward and provides you with advice and strategies for success.

8. No Quit Living

Genre: Business/Motivational

Host Christopher Wirth interviews entrepreneurs, speakers, social media gurus, marketing and branding professionals, authors, and many, many others on his podcast. The common theme is that the guests on the show all share stories of perseverance and never giving up. Through these stories, you’ll learn about small business tips, growth, media, and press. Wirth inspires listeners to keep on going even when times get tough.

9. Lore

Genre: Horror/Non-fiction mystery

Lore follows historical scary stories and the legends that surrounds them. Each episode explores dark, spooky stories that really happened. It’s hosted by Aaron Mahnke. So, if you like spooky stories – made even spookier by the fact that they actually happened – this podcast might be for you.

10. Duct Tape Marketing

Genre: Small business/Marketing

John Jantsch interviews authors and marketers to bring you tips about growing your business. He shares marketing tips, advice, strategies, and resources.

So, if you’re getting bored listening to the same old radio stations or the same old music playlists, check out one of these podcasts for truckers. If you find a genre or a subject matter that you like, you can find others that are similar, so not to worry when you finish one! Feed your mind with podcasts and watch as the miles fly by.
